3. Jacques Torres, DUMBO, Rockefeller Center, SoHo, Upper West Side

Award-winning French Chef Jacques Torres gained his expertise touring the globe with two-star Michelin chef Jacques Maximin at Hotel Negresco, as the Corporate Pastry Chef for the Ritz-Carlton and popular New York restaurant Le Cirque. He realized his American dream in 2000 when he opened up his first chocolate shop in DUMBO, venturing out as the first artisan chocolatier in the U.S. to start with cocoa beans when making his own chocolate. Chocoholics can now enjoy his mouth-watering works of art at five cozy boutiques throughout the city.
